在数字化时代,Web前端技术是构建用户界面和交互体验的核心。作为一个对新鲜事物充满好奇的16岁少年,你或许对如何快速掌握Web前端技术,解决入门难题充满期待。本文将为你揭开Web前端技术的神秘面纱,并提供一些实用的学习技巧。

前端技术概览

Web前端技术主要包括以下几部分:

  1. HTML(超文本标记语言):这是构建网页结构的基础。
  2. CSS(层叠样式表):用于美化网页,控制布局和样式。
  3. JavaScript:实现网页的动态效果和交互功能。

入门步骤

1. 理解基础概念

首先,你需要了解什么是Web前端以及它的重要性。Web前端开发者负责用户直接看到的网页界面,因此,掌握前端技术是成为一名优秀网页开发者的关键。

2. 学习HTML

HTML是网页的基本骨架。你可以通过在线教程、书籍或者视频课程来学习。以下是一些学习HTML的步骤:

  • 熟悉标签:如<html>, <head>, <body>, <h1><h6>, <p>, <a>等。
  • 理解文档类型声明(DOCTYPE):它定义了HTML文档的类型。
  • 学习表格、列表、表单等元素:这些是网页中常用的结构化元素。

3. 掌握CSS

CSS用于美化网页,你需要了解如何使用CSS选择器来选择HTML元素,并设置样式。以下是一些CSS学习要点:

  • 选择器:如元素选择器、类选择器、ID选择器等。
  • 盒模型:了解元素的边距、边框和填充。
  • 布局:学习使用CSS布局技术,如Flexbox和Grid。

4. 学习JavaScript

JavaScript是使网页动起来的关键。以下是一些JavaScript学习要点:

  • 变量和类型:了解如何声明和使用变量。
  • 函数:学习如何定义和使用函数。
  • DOM操作:DOM(文档对象模型)是JavaScript操作网页内容的接口。

实用技巧

1. 使用在线工具

利用在线工具如CodePen、JSFiddle等,可以让你快速实践和测试代码。

2. 参考优秀网站

浏览一些优秀的前端网站,学习他们的设计和编码风格。

3. 编写注释

在代码中添加注释可以帮助你更好地理解自己的代码,也便于他人阅读。

4. 学习版本控制

掌握Git等版本控制工具,可以帮助你管理代码和项目。

5. 加入社区

加入前端开发社区,如Stack Overflow、Reddit的r/webdev等,可以让你与同行交流,解决问题。

常见入门难题解答

问题1:HTML、CSS和JavaScript的关系是什么?

  • HTML构建网页结构,CSS美化布局,JavaScript使网页交互。

问题2:如何解决浏览器兼容性问题?

  • 使用跨浏览器框架如Bootstrap,或者了解不同浏览器的兼容性差异。

问题3:如何提高网页性能?

  • 压缩图片和CSS文件,使用CDN(内容分发网络)等。

总结

掌握Web前端技术并非一蹴而就,需要时间和耐心。但只要你遵循正确的学习路径,不断实践和探索,你将能够轻松解决入门难题,成为一名合格的前端开发者。祝你学习愉快!